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07635417 30 16 493717
3546263565 834 75382090113
3546263565 834 75382090113
397 084492 8222621342
All about undefined
Interested in learning more?
3546263565 834 75382090113
397 084492 8222621342
See more
449 5447
72 3402194955 9228926
See more
90293837 2610393 007
8278406142 328741 020410 6493677
See more